This role is responsible for implementing and managing cost control strategies to ensure effective financial management and project profitability. Key duties include monitoring and analyzing financial data, preparing reports and budget forecasts, coordinating with project managers to track costs, reviewing and approving expenses, conducting audits, and identifying cost-saving opportunities. The position also involves training and mentoring cost control staff, supporting the finance team, collaborating on efficiency initiatives, staying updated on industry best practices, and ensuring compliance with Hill International's quality, safety, and environmental policies, along with other assigned tasks.
